parenting is a universal experience, but each culture and region may have its own unique challenges and traditions when it comes to raising children. In the Democratic Republic of Congo, parenting practices are deeply rooted in traditional values and customs, while also adapting to the modern world. Here are some parenting tips and advice for families in Congo: 1. **Emphasize Respect** - In Congolese culture, respect for elders is highly valued. Parents can instill this value in their children by modeling respectful behavior and teaching them to greet and interact politely with adults. 2. **Maintain Strong Family Bonds** - Family ties are crucial in Congolese society. Parents should prioritize spending quality time with their children, engaging in activities together, and fostering a sense of unity and support within the family. 3. **Teach Cultural Traditions** - Congo is a diverse country with many different ethnic groups, each with its own unique traditions and customs. Parents can educate their children about their cultural heritage through storytelling, music, dance, and traditional ceremonies. 4. **Encourage Education** - Education is highly valued in Congolese society, and parents play a key role in supporting their children's academic success. Encourage a love for learning, provide resources for schoolwork, and communicate regularly with teachers to monitor progress. 5. **Promote Healthy Living** - In a country where access to healthcare can be limited, parents should focus on preventive measures to keep their children healthy. This includes promoting good hygiene practices, nutritious eating habits, regular exercise, and seeking medical care when needed. 6. **Instill Strong Moral Values** - Honesty, integrity, and compassion are important values in Congo. Parents should teach their children the importance of kindness, empathy, and standing up for what is right. 7. **Address Discipline Appropriately** - Discipline is a challenging aspect of parenting in any culture. In Congo, parents may use a combination of traditional methods, such as verbal correction and consequences, along with positive reinforcement to encourage good behavior. 8. **Encourage Independence** - While family ties are strong in Congolese culture, parents should also empower their children to develop independence and critical thinking skills. Encourage them to express their opinions and make decisions while providing guidance and support. 9. **Seek Support** - Parenting can be tough, no matter where you are in the world. Don't hesitate to reach out to family members, friends, or support groups for advice, encouragement, and assistance when needed. Parenting in Congo, Africa, presents a unique set of challenges and joys. By embracing cultural values, fostering strong family bonds, promoting education and healthy living, and instilling moral values, parents can help their children thrive and grow into responsible, compassionate adults.
